Dealing With the Knocked-Out Tooth



If you have knocked senseless a tooth, handle it thoroughly to enhance the opportunities of successful reattachment. Initially, find the tooth and select it up by the crown, avoiding touching the origin. It's critical to keep the tooth wet, so when possible, attempt to gently put it back into the socket.

If that's not practical, save the tooth in a container with milk or your saliva to maintain it moistened. Keep in mind not to scrub or clean the tooth with any type of chemicals, as this can damage the delicate cells required for reattachment.

Prevent wrapping the tooth in cells or fabric, as this can result in dehydration. Time is important, so seek oral treatment immediately. The longer the tooth runs out its socket, the reduced the possibilities of successful reimplantation.

Immediate First Aid Tips



Beginning by carefully washing your mouth with lukewarm water to clean the area around the knocked-out tooth. This will aid eliminate any kind of dust or debris that may be present. Beware not to scrub or touch the root of the tooth, as this can trigger additional damage.

Next, preferably, try to position the tooth back right into its socket. If you can not reinsert the tooth, don't force it. Instead, keep it wet by putting it in a mug of milk or saline remedy. Avoid saving the tooth in water as it can damage the root cells.

To manage any kind of blood loss, use gentle pressure to the area utilizing a tidy gauze or cloth. You can also use a chilly compress to lower swelling and eliminate discomfort. Bear in mind to take over-the-counter pain medicine as required.
